After you submit the SUNY app, admissions will reach out by email giving you instructions for setting up the "status checker" portal. On there you submit your resume and prerequisite form. Also, you can see if they received your transcripts. Once everything has a green checkmark (and there are no red x's), your app is considered complete. If you've done all that, then you just have to wait for decisions to roll out! Most decisions will be made in December and January, I was told.
